Re: Corporation Bank Clerk through IBPS

Of course the Corporation Bank has declared list of Candidates Selected for the Post of Probationary Clerks through IBPS score, but the eligible candidates will be issued with appointment orders after verification of Documents sent by IBPS and fulfillment of eligibility criteria in the Advertisement.

Candidates may note that the allotment by ibps is for the entire year upto 31.03.2016.

The appointment orders with postings will be issued in phased manners depending upon the vacancy position in the order of merit, category-wise.

Look friend IBPS is an organisation which do the hiring for the Bank clerk for most of the Banks including Corporation Bank and will depend on the cutt off the Bank.

I am giving you the process which IBPS do for the Clerk recruitment

Selection Process:

The selection process carried out in three stages,

Preliminary Examination

Main Examination and

Common Interviews conducted by IBPS.

1. Common Written Examination:

Institute of Banking Personnel Selection (IBPS) conducts Online Exam for Clerical Cadre posts.

The examination will be two tier i.e. the online examination will be held in two phases, preliminary and main.

Preliminary exam

Total marks of Preliminary exam is 100

Duration of 1 hour for objective type questions &

Main exam’

Total marks of Main exam is 200

Duration of 2 hours for objective type questions.

All the tests except the Test of English Language will be available in English and Hindi.

Applicant will have to secure a minimum score in each test and also on total to be considered to be called for interview.

Common Interview:

Applicants who have been shortlisted in the examination for CWE Clerks-V will subsequently be called for an Interview to be conducted by the Participating Organisations

Interviews will be conducted at select centres.

The total marks allotted for Interview are 100.

The minimum qualifying marks in interview will not be less than 40% (35% for SC/ ST/ OBC/ PWD/ EXSM candidates).


The weightage (ratio) of CWE (Main exam) and interview will be 80:20 respectively.

The combined final score of candidates shall be arrived at on the basis of scores obtained by the candidates in CWE Clerks- IV and Interview.
